GPU Kernel Engineer (Remote)
29200-43800 PLN miesięcznie (B2B)
Alcor
Czym będziesz się zajmować?
We are open for seniors, mids, and juniors (of course, then with lower salary), but at least first experience with GPU performance and kernel optimization is must have.
Remote
- Explore and analyze performance bottlenecks in ML training and inference.
- Develop and optimize high-performance computing kernels in Triton, CUDA, and/or ROCm.
- Implement programming solutions in C/C++ and Python.
- Deep dive into GPU performance optimizations to maximize efficiency and speed.
- Collaborate with the team to extend and improve existing machine learning compilers or frameworks such as MLIR, Pytorch, Tensorflow, ONNX Runtime, TensorRT. (This is optional but beneficial)
Kogo poszukujemy?
Qualifications:- Strong programming skills in C/C++ and Python.
- Deep understanding and experience in GPU performance optimizations.
- Proven experience with kernel optimizations on CUDA, ROCm, or other accelerators.
- General experience with the training and deployment of ML models
- Experience with distributed systems development or distributed ML workloads
- Bachelor's, Masters or PhDs degree in Computer Science, Electrical Engineering, or a related field.
- Experience with innovative OSS projects like FlashAttention, mlc-llm, vllm, SGLang.
- Experience with machine learning compilers or frameworks such as TVM, MLIR, Pytorch, Tensorflow, ONNX Runtime, TensorRT.
Czego wymagamy?
Znajomości:
Języki:
- Angielski
Jakie warunki i benefity otrzymasz?
- 8000-12000 USD miesięcznie (B2B)
- B2B - Elastyczne godziny pracy (100%)
- Praca zdalna: W całości
Gdzie będziesz pracował?
Zdalnie
Kim jesteśmy?
Alcor is a recruitment service provider with an exclusive focus on tech positions for IT product companies that would like to hire in LATAM, Poland, Romania, and other countries in Eastern Europe.
With our hands-on experience in local markets, we offer access to 600,000+ talented developers in Poland, Romania, Ukraine, and other Eastern European countries to assist you in setting up or expanding your overseas development team.